Anxiety can be described as negative feelings of psychological tension and general unease. These feelings can range from subtle and ignorable to intense and overwhelming enough to trigger panic attacks and feelings of impending doom.

Anxiety can be caused by environmental factors, it can be an inescapable effect of the drug itself, it can be due to a lack of experience with the substance or it can be triggered by the experience of negative hallucinations.
